How they compare

Estonia currently reports 1,620 against 239.8 in Central Asia, a difference of 1,380.

That makes Estonia's figure about 6.8 times Central Asia's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Central Asia ahead.

Central Asia ranks 15th and Estonia ranks 20th of 30 groups.

Across the 3 decades both report, Central Asia averaged higher in 1 and Estonia in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Central Asia Estonia Difference Ahead
2000s 185.89 36.61 149.28 Central Asia
2010s 188.92 397.76 208.84 Estonia
2020s 211.02 982.59 771.58 Estonia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
